Question : 2

I don’t have / any money to / spend for luxuries. / No error

a) any money to

b) spend for luxuries.

c) I don’t have

d) No error

Answer: (b)

It is preposition related error.

Hence, spend on luxuries .... should be used.

Question : 4

This is an urgent / matter which may admit / of few delays. / No error

a) matter which may admit

b) of few delays.

c) This is an urgent

d) No error

Answer: (b)

As the sense suggests, of no delays (negative) .... should be used.
